Lenovo-owned Motorola is yet to officially announce the Moto Z2 Force but an official-looking press render of the smartphone has been leaked online today.

The leaked render of the Motorola Moto Z2 Force was received by the folks over at Android Authority. It gives us a good look at Lenovo’s next flagship smartphone which will be sold under the Motorola banner. The scribe says that it has received this render from a trusted source.

As far as the design is concerned, it doesn’t appear to be that different from the Moto Z2 Play, which has been leaked previously. The biggest difference is noticeable at the back where the Moto Z2 Force has a dual camera system.

The full details about the specifications are not available as yet but previous reports have suggested that the Moto Z2 Force is going to have a 5.5 inch Full HD display and a Qualcomm Snapdragon 835 processor.

No word as yet on when Motorola is going to officially announce this device, it may happen at some point over the summer this year.
